Why Start an ADHD Medication Trial? The Basics

Medication trials are a cornerstone of ADHD treatment, often recommended after behavioral therapies. According to the latest guidelines from trusted sources like the CDC and CHADD, stimulants like methylphenidate or amphetamines work for 70-80% of children by boosting dopamine and norepinephrine in the brain.

Expect a structured process: Your pediatrician or specialist 🩺 will select a medication based on your child's age, symptoms, and health history. Trials typically last 4-6 weeks, with dose tweaks along the way. Ready to dive into the phases?

Phase 1: Preparation Before the Trial Begins

Success starts with prep. Here's your checklist:

  • Comprehensive evaluation: Rule out co-existing conditions like anxiety or sleep issues.
  • Baseline tracking: Log your child's symptoms using tools like the ADHD Rating Scale for 1-2 weeks pre-trial.
  • Discuss family history: Genetics influence response rates.
  • Choose the right med: Common starters include short-acting stimulants for quick feedback.

Pro tip: Schedule follow-ups now—weekly calls or visits ensure safety.

Common ADHD Medications: Quick Comparison
Medication Type Examples Duration Best For
Stimulants (Short-acting) Ritalin, Dexedrine 3-4 hours Trial starters, flexible dosing
Stimulants (Long-acting) Adderall XR, Concerta 8-12 hours School-day coverage
Non-Stimulants Strattera, Intuniv 24 hours If stimulants fail or cause side effects

Phase 2: Week 1 – The Initial Dosing and Observation

What to expect during an ADHD medication trial kicks off with a low dose to minimize risks. Day 1-3: Watch for immediate effects like improved attention or hyperactivity reduction. Common early wins include better homework completion.

Track daily with a journal:

  • Morning: Dose given? Appetite before?
  • Afternoon: Focus at school? Any crashes?
  • Evening: Sleep quality? Mood?

Side effects? 20-30% experience appetite loss or insomnia initially—these often fade. If severe (e.g., tics), call your doctor immediately.

Phase 3: Weeks 2-4 – Dose Adjustments and Fine-Tuning

By week 2, you'll notice patterns. Expect 1-2 dose increases if needed—up to 1mg/kg/day for stimulants, per latest protocols. Your parent’s roadmap includes:

  1. Teacher feedback: Share report cards or notes.
  2. Behavioral scales: Reassess symptoms weekly.
  3. Lifestyle tweaks: Pair meds with routines like consistent bedtimes.

If no response after max dose? Switch meds—trials allow this flexibility. Non-responders (about 20%) thrive on alternatives.

Managing Side Effects: Your Proactive Guide

Side effects are temporary for most, but knowledge empowers you. Here's a focused overview:

ADHD Medication Side Effects & Solutions
Side Effect Frequency Management
Appetite suppression Common (50%+) High-calorie snacks, "eat-first" dosing
Insomnia Moderate Earlier doses, no screens pre-bed
Irritability/Rebound Common Dose timing, behavioral therapy
Rare: Heart issues <1% Baseline EKG if family history

For growth concerns, latest data shows minimal long-term impact with monitoring. Consult AAP guidelines for reassurance.

Phase 4: Long-Term Monitoring and Success Metrics

Trials evolve into maintenance. After 4-6 weeks, evaluate:

  • 70% symptom reduction? Optimal dose found! 🎉
  • Partial response? Combo therapy (meds + therapy).
  • No benefit? Discontinue safely—half-life allows quick taper.

FAQs: Answering Your Top Concerns

Q: How long until I see results in an ADHD medication trial?
A: 30-60 minutes for stimulants; full effects in 1-2 weeks.

Q: Is addiction a risk?
A: Low when prescribed properly—latest studies confirm safety for kids.

Q: What if my child hates the taste?
A: Liquid options or capsules exist.
